Preparing Your First Backpack Trip: A Step-by-Step Guide
Embarking on your inaugural backpacking adventure can be both exhilarating and daunting. To ensure a smooth and enjoyable experience, meticulous preparation is essential. This thorough guide will equip you with the necessary steps to master your first backpacking trip with self-belief.
- Firstly, select your destination. Consider factors like length of the trail, landscape, and the time of year.
- Then, create a detailed itinerary that comprises all necessary stops for water, food, and shelter. Precisely calculate the time required to cover each section of the trail.
- Pack your gear with precision. Prioritise lightweight and multifunctional items. Don't forget essential items like a map, compass, first-aid kit, and adequate attire for varying weather conditions.
- Lastly, condition yourself physically by engaging in regular hiking and stamina-building exercises. This will guarantee you with the necessary endurance to finish your backpacking trip.
Remember that safety should always be your foremost concern.

Leave No Trace, Carry Only Memories: Sustainable Backpacking Practices
Venturing into the wilderness is a rewarding experience that unites us with nature's grandeur. Yet, it's our responsibility to tread lightly and protect these pristine environments for generations to come. Embracing sustainable backpacking practices ensures that we leave no trace behind, allowing future explorers to enjoy the same untouched beauty.
- Organize your trip meticulously, choosing established trails and campsites to minimize impact on sensitive areas.
- Packminimalistically essential gear and supplies, reducing waste and unnecessary burden.
- Manage waste responsibly by packing out everything you pack in, utilizing designated trash receptacles when available.
Let's aim to be responsible stewards of the wilderness, leaving behind only memories and ensuring that these natural treasures remain unspoiled for all to enjoy.
